标签: keycloak-spring-boot-starter

如何在 Spring Boot 中使用 keycloak-admin-client 使用电子邮件启用 2FA

我的要求是在 Keycloak 中使用电子邮件启用 2FA。

启用后,如果用户尝试通过电子邮件和密码登录,用户成功通过身份验证后,基于时间的令牌将发送到电子邮件。

用户将通过自定义 UI 执行此操作,即在我们的产品中,我们有 UI 为用户启用/禁用 2FA。

我们正在使用 Keycloak 并且我们希望使用 Keycloak API 来实现这一点。

我正在使用 keycloak-admin-client 与 Keycloak API 进行交互,但我没有找到足够的资源来使用 keycloak-admin-client 实现此目的。

我正在寻找一种使用 keycloak-admin-client 为用户启用 2FA 的方法。

任何帮助将不胜感激。

谢谢

keycloak keycloak-rest-api keycloak-admin-client keycloak-spring-boot-starter

1
推荐指数
1
解决办法
5165
查看次数